The Spanish Verb Saber As you can see, in English, “to know” is an important verb. However, in Spanish this verb is translated as two different verbs: saber and conocer. They both mean “to know,” but we use them in different contexts.

What type of irregular verb is saber?

What type of verb is saber? The verb saber is irregular as it does not follow the usual pattern for Spanish verbs ending in “-er”. Moreover, saber (meaning “to know”) can be a transitive or an intransitive verb depending on the context. This means it might require an object to function or not.

What is saber in nosotros form?

I know when the party starts: Yo sé cuándo empieza la fiesta….How to Conjugate Saber and Conocer.

Saber
yo sé nosotros sabemos
tú sabes vosotros sabéis
él/ella/usted sabe ellos/ellas/ustedes saben

Is Saber irregular in Spanish?

Updated February 24, 2019. Saber, a common Spanish verb usually meaning “to know” in the sense of having knowledge, is highly irregular. Both the stem and the endings can take unexpected forms. Saber should not be confused with conocer, which also means “to know,” but in the sense of being familiar with a person.

What is the difference between conocer and Saber?

Saber should not be confused with conocer, which also means “to know,” but in the sense of being familiar with a person. Conocer also is conjugated irregularly.
